Consider this scenario: A luxury fashion brand recognized for its bespoke craftsmanship and exclusive clientele is facing challenges in maintaining competitive pricing while upholding its high-quality sourcing standards.

With a recent expansion into new international markets, the company needs to optimize its sourcing strategy to ensure cost efficiency, maintain brand integrity, and meet the increasing demand without compromising on the luxury experience.



In reviewing the situation, it becomes apparent that the root causes of the company's challenges may stem from an over-reliance on a limited number of suppliers and a lack of strategic partnerships that could offer competitive pricing without sacrificing quality. Another hypothesis could be that the current sourcing processes lack the agility to respond to market changes, leading to inefficiencies and increased costs.

Strategic Analysis and Execution Methodology

The path to addressing these Strategic Sourcing challenges is through a proven 4-phase methodology that ensures thorough analysis and effective execution. This methodology has been designed to deliver actionable insights and sustainable results, benefitting from the cumulative experience of leading consulting firms.

  1. Assessment and Benchmarking:
    • Evaluate current sourcing strategies against industry benchmarks.
    • Identify cost drivers and areas for potential savings.
    • Conduct supplier market analysis to explore alternative sources.
  2. Strategy Development:
    • Formulate sourcing strategies aligned with the brand's luxury positioning.
    • Develop a supplier relationship management plan to foster partnerships.
    • Include risk management strategies for supply chain resilience.
  3. Implementation Planning:
    • Create a phased rollout plan for the new sourcing strategy.
    • Develop performance metrics and monitoring systems.
    • Establish a change management framework to ensure smooth adoption.
  4. Continuous Improvement and Optimization:
    • Implement a feedback loop for ongoing strategy refinement.
    • Use data analytics to drive decision-making and identify trends.
    • Regularly review supplier performance and the strategic sourcing framework.

Alignment with Luxury Brand Values

Ensuring that Strategic Sourcing initiatives align with the brand's luxury values is paramount. The methodologies applied must enhance, not detract from, the brand's image. This means sourcing materials that meet the highest standards of quality and ethical sourcing. According to Bain & Company's Luxury Goods Worldwide Market Study, consumers increasingly associate luxury with sustainability and ethics. Therefore, Strategic Sourcing must also focus on traceability and the responsible sourcing of raw materials to maintain consumer trust and brand prestige.

Furthermore, the selection of suppliers goes beyond cost considerations. It involves a careful evaluation of craftsmanship, reliability, and the ability to co-create exclusive products. In doing so, the brand not only ensures the quality of its products but also fosters innovation through collaborative relationships with its suppliers.

Supplier Relationship Management

Robust Supplier Relationship Management (SRM) is crucial for the success of a Strategic Sourcing strategy, especially in the luxury sector where quality and exclusivity are non-negotiable. By developing strategic partnerships with suppliers, companies can secure preferential treatment, such as access to premium materials and the latest innovations. A study by PwC highlighted that companies with high-performing SRM programs report a 15% higher profit margin than their peers. This underscores the financial as well as the strategic value of investing in SRM.

Effective SRM also involves regular performance reviews and collaborative problem-solving, fostering a sense of partnership rather than a transactional relationship. This approach not only improves the quality and exclusivity of the materials sourced but also ensures a more resilient supply chain capable of adapting to changing market conditions.

Cost Efficiency and Investment Return

While Strategic Sourcing is expected to yield cost savings, executives are often concerned with the return on investment (ROI) and the time frame for realizing these savings. According to McKinsey & Company, companies that engage in comprehensive Strategic Sourcing practices can expect to see a 7-12% reduction in costs. However, these savings are not immediate and typically materialize over the course of one to two years as the sourcing strategy is fully implemented and suppliers are optimized.

Moreover, the investment into Strategic Sourcing is not solely measured in cost savings but also in brand value and market position. By ensuring a supply chain that is both cost-efficient and aligned with luxury standards, the company not only improves its margins but also reinforces its competitive advantage in the luxury market.

Adaptability to Market Changes

In the dynamic luxury market, adaptability is key. A Strategic Sourcing strategy must be flexible enough to respond to rapid market changes, such as shifts in consumer preferences or disruptions in the supply chain. For instance, Gartner reports that supply chain leaders who actively leverage flexibility strategies can reduce the impact of disruptions by up to 30%. This highlights the importance of building a sourcing strategy that is robust yet adaptable, with contingency planning as a core component.

By incorporating scenario planning and real-time market analytics into the sourcing process, luxury brands can quickly adjust their strategies to mitigate risks and seize new opportunities. This agility is essential not only for maintaining operational continuity but also for ensuring that the brand remains relevant and responsive to evolving market trends.

Key Findings and Results

Here is a summary of the key results of this case study:

  • Reduced sourcing costs by 15% through the implementation of the strategic sourcing methodology, surpassing the initial target of 15% as projected by McKinsey & Company.
  • Improved supplier performance, reliability, and responsiveness, as evidenced by a 20% increase in the Supplier Performance Scorecards metrics.
  • Streamlined sourcing cycle time, achieving a 25% reduction in the time taken from identifying a need to securing a supplier, enhancing operational efficiency.
  • Enhanced brand reputation and customer satisfaction through the establishment of strategic partnerships, contributing to a 10% increase in customer loyalty and positive brand sentiment.

The initiative has yielded significant cost reductions and operational improvements, aligning with the strategic objectives outlined in the report. The achievement of a 15% reduction in sourcing costs demonstrates the effectiveness of the implemented methodology. The enhanced supplier performance and streamlined cycle time further validate the success of the initiative, indicating improved operational efficiency and reliability. However, the initiative fell short in addressing the adaptability to market changes, as evidenced by the lack of specific metrics or outcomes related to flexibility and responsiveness to dynamic market shifts. To enhance the outcomes, a more robust focus on adaptability and scenario planning could have been integrated into the strategy, enabling the organization to respond more effectively to market dynamics and disruptions. Additionally, while the cost savings were substantial, the time frame for realizing these savings was longer than anticipated, suggesting a need for more agile and immediate cost-saving measures to complement the long-term strategic sourcing approach.

Building on the initiative's success, the organization should consider integrating real-time market analytics and scenario planning into the sourcing strategy to enhance adaptability and responsiveness to market changes. Additionally, a focus on immediate cost-saving measures alongside the long-term strategic sourcing approach can further optimize the cost efficiency and investment return. Continuous monitoring and refinement of the supplier relationship management framework are recommended to sustain and enhance the established partnerships, ensuring ongoing benefits and exclusivity in sourcing materials.
